Summary

Amends the Private College Act and the Academic Degree Act. Provides that a nonprofit institution owned, controlled, and operated and maintained by a bona fide church, religious denomination, or religious organization comprised of multi-denominational members of the same well-recognized religion, lawfully operating as a nonprofit religious corporation pursuant to the Religious Corporation Act, is exempt from the Acts if (i) the education is limited to instruction in the principles of that church, religious denomination, or religious organization or to courses offered for the purpose of training the adherents of that church, religious denomination, or religious organization in the care of the sick in accordance with its religious tenets and (ii) the diploma or degree is limited to evidence of completion of that education and the meritorious recognition upon which any honorary degree is conferred is limited to the principles of that church, religious denomination, or religious organization. Sets forth requirements and prohibitions concerning the awarding of degrees and diplomas by such an institution. Requires the institution to annually file with the Board of Higher Education evidence to demonstrate its status as a nonprofit religious corporation under the Religious Corporation Act. Effective July 1, 2014.
